Min Woo Lee earned his first PGA Tour win on Sunday at the Texas Children’s Houston Open, but he won in nail-biting fashion.
The 26-year-old Aussie once held a five-shot lead during the final round at Memorial Park before closing the deal by one shot over Scottie Scheffler and Gary Woodland.
As well as a maiden title on US soil, Lee bagged a cool $1.71 million.
It was part of a boosted prize money payout at the Texas Children’s Houston Open, where a share of $9.5 million was up for grabs. It was also the largest purse of the season so far, outside the Signature Events.
Meanwhile, it pushed Lee to a career high of world No.22, as the Masters looms.
A tie for second place was pretty much the perfect preparation for Scheffler, banking $845,000 ahead of his title defence at Augusta National next week.
